Kip Gebakken In Olijfolie, or chicken fried in olive oil, is a simple yet flavorful dish rooted in Mediterranean cuisine. The recipe typically includes boneless chicken seasoned with spices like garlic, paprika, or thyme, then pan-fried in extra virgin olive oil. Olive oil, a staple in Mediterranean cooking, is rich in monounsaturated fats and antioxidants, promoting heart health and reducing inflammation. The chicken provides lean protein, essential for muscle health and energy. This dish is a healthier alternative to deep-fried chicken, as olive oil imparts flavor while avoiding the use of heavily processed oils. However, moderation is key, as frying—even in olive oil—can still increase calorie content. Pairing it with fresh vegetables or whole grains can balance the meal for optimal nutrition.
